Richard Ruccolo, a Pisces, recently turned 26 on March 2. A newcomer to Hollywood, he was turned down by fourteen different agencies in three weeks before he landed a guest-starring role on "Beverly Hills, 90210". Immediately thereafter, he secured the lead role in Charlie Peters' play, "Playback," at the Court Theater.

His film credits include "Live Long Drink Juice," "Music From Another Room" and "Life at the End of Time." He has also appeared in numerous national commercials, including those for Diet Coke, 7-Up, Wendy's and Skittles.

He was inspired to become an actor after playing the lead role in "Oklahoma". Since then, he has returned to musicals to perform in "Something's Afoot" and "West Side Story." Now, his musical tastes run more towards the group "Blessed Union of Souls".
Originally from New Jersey, Ruccolo lives in Los Angeles. He is single and looking, mostly for companionship, from both a girlfriend and a dog.
